Output 9566018443ebb53d9f9faf5ee86d7ae946ce443875c6779f52dc8e81da87d3ba:2

value
199376
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24a963998bf76571d5c61602f3a39fe5fcd9092d OP_EQUALVERIFY OP_CHECKSIG
address
14LrFGKsokqxHpBRyh6sXXttVWTS7qgpbE
transaction
9566018443ebb53d9f9faf5ee86d7ae946ce443875c6779f52dc8e81da87d3ba
spent
true